Output ec6153181ea345ce8887dbf2bde82fb15c1e472a10e3bf67d03d862cff7b6de4:0

value
709532
script pubkey
OP_0 OP_PUSHBYTES_20 e30219b1e42f13d184cb10d3a0b7f7df74b521e6
address
bc1quvppnv0y9ufarpxtzrf6pdlhma6t2g0xrkz53m
transaction
ec6153181ea345ce8887dbf2bde82fb15c1e472a10e3bf67d03d862cff7b6de4
confirmations
3933
spent
true